I got the latest git and yes, the size is kept down. I've only tried with a smaller repository but it looks promising. When I ran git-cvsimport witho= ut a CVS-module name (wanting the entire repository), it gave me a Usage message indicating that the CVS-module name was optional - but it isn't :) I did have to change 2 lines in git-cvsimport to get it to run with my 5.8.0 perl (problems with POSIX errno). I've attached a patch but my work around isn't as quick as what it replaced. Many thanks, I'll have a go with the big repository at work tomorrow! Cheers, Geoff Russell P.S.
